FAQ
How much does window installation cost in Des Moines?
In Des Moines, Iowa, window installation costs typically range from $478 to over $2,412 per window, depending on the style, size, and whether you choose a pocket or full-frame installation. Get multiple quotes to find the best price for your specific needs.
Can I install windows myself in Des Moines?
DIY window installation is possible, but it requires careful preparation, including waterproofing and proper flashing to avoid leaks. In Des Moines, it's important to follow local building codes and manufacturer guidelines. If you're not experienced, hiring a professional is recommended.
What factors affect window installation cost in Des Moines?
Factors affecting window installation cost in Des Moines include the window style (double-hung, casement, etc.), the number of windows, whether it's a pocket or full-frame replacement, and local labor rates. Energy-efficient windows may have higher upfront costs but can save on utility bills.
What is the proper way to install a window?
The proper way to install a window involves preparing the opening, installing a waterproof pan, shimming the window to level and plumb, and properly flashing the exterior to prevent water intrusion. In Des Moines, comply with local building codes and manufacturer instructions for best results.
